Birmingham-Shuttlesworth International Airport (BHM) does not offer nonstop service to Tokyo Narita International Airport (NRT), so every itinerary on this route connects through a major hub. The two primary carriers serving this corridor are All Nippon Airways and Japan Airlines, both of which operate wide-body international aircraft on the transpacific leg. Connecting hub options typically include cities such as Los Angeles, San Francisco, Chicago, and Dallas, with total travel time averaging around 15 hours of airborne flight.

How much does business class from Birmingham to Tokyo actually cost? Round-trip pricing in business class starts near $2,800 during off-peak periods and can reach $7,300 or higher during peak travel windows like Golden Week in late April and early May, or the December holiday season. The most consistent value windows are January, February, March, April, October, and November, when demand softens and private fare inventory opens up at significantly reduced rates.

Japan Airlines, known as JAL, offers a comparable premium product on transpacific routes and is a frequent choice among frequent flyers who prioritize Japanese hospitality standards at 35,000 feet. Both carriers serve Tokyo Narita International Airport (NRT), which remains the primary international gateway for North America–East Asia traffic.
